A recessive disease might also be check here X-connected recessive. Which means the modified gene is on the X chromosome. Women have two X chromosomes, and males have one X and one Y chromosome. Since ladies have two X chromosomes, they are often carriers of a nonworking gene on one in their X chromosomes. But they aren't impacted by a disease if the other X has a normal copy of the gene. Males in many cases are afflicted by a disease if they've the changed gene on their own only duplicate in the X chromosome. It is because they don’t have the traditional copy of your gene about the Y chromosome. copyright testing for X-linked problems is frequently performed in women.
